I thrived in the primitive tribe
Chapter 58 Parting
Watching the two little ones scrambling for food in the ceramic bowl, Lu Yao said gently, "Don't worry, there's more here."
The alpha wolf seemed to have lowered its guard against the two. After watching the cubs for a while, it strolled over to its mate, nuzzled her with its head, and after confirming that its mate was sleeping soundly, it lowered its head, picked up the roasted meat, tasted it, and then moved the rest to the two cubs.
Just then, the meat broth in the earthenware bowl was almost gone. The leader put the roasted meat into the bowl, and the two little ones looked up at their father, then lowered their heads again to start gnawing on the roasted meat.
Lu Yao glanced at the earthenware pot; there wasn't much broth left. She poured the remaining broth into a bowl while the wolf cubs were tearing at the roasted meat, and then prepared to return to her tribe.
"Wolf leader, I need to use this earthenware bowl to hold medicine for your mate. I'll take it back first." Lu Yao turned to the alpha wolf as if she had just thought of something, and then pointed to the earthenware bowl next to the mother wolf. After feeding her the medicine, she hadn't taken the bowl back and had left it there.
The alpha wolf looked in the direction she pointed, carried the ceramic bowl to Lu Yao's side, and then watched as Lu Yao and the other person left hand in hand.
The other wolves only paid attention to this side at the beginning. After seeing that their leader did not launch an attack, they began to eat their dinner amidst the aroma of meat.
The two returned to their companions, picked up the food given to them by their tribesmen, and began to eat heartily.
"Why do these wolves seem so intelligent?"
"Yes, especially that alpha wolf."
As Lu Yao ate, she listened to the others discussing how unusual this wolf pack was. "Can wolf cubs eat meat right after birth?"
The group looked at each other, puzzled as to why Lu Yao would ask such a strange question.
"Normally, newborn wolf pups should only be able to drink their mother's milk."
"How could those two wolf cubs eat roasted meat, and it seemed like they ate it without any problems?"
“I suspect this alpha wolf is the wolf king,” Loya interjected.
"The Wolf King! It's actually the Wolf King?" Lu Yao was very puzzled when she saw her companion's surprised look.
"What's the difference between a wolf king and an ordinary local wolf?"
"Legend has it that the wolf king not only possesses a mind more intelligent than any other territorial wolf, but also makes the wisest decisions during every hunt and migration, leading the pack to avoid danger and capture abundant food. Moreover, its body is stronger, with taut muscles and astonishing strength. Even when facing the fiercest enemies, the wolf king never backs down and can always turn the tide of battle single-handedly, protecting the safety of the pack."
"Is the Wolf King really that powerful?" Lu Yao asked, puzzled, as she listened to her tribesmen's explanation.
"Yes, but the wolf king rarely comes out. It usually stays in its own territory. Why would it lead the pack here?"
"Isn't the Wolf King's territory around here?"
"Yes, legend has it that the Wolf King's territory is located closer to the volcano, far away from here."
"Legend? So this means it's the first time you've ever seen the Wolf King?"
"Yes, according to legend, every wolf pack has an alpha wolf, meaning there are as many alpha wolves as there are wolf packs, but there is only one wolf king."
"Is that so?"
"That's how it's been passed down since ancient times, so it shouldn't be wrong."
Listening to her companion's story, Lu Yao felt that she had gained a deeper understanding of this continent.
For the next few days, the sun remained warm and bright, shining on the saltwater lake. They continued to make salt as usual, but in addition to brewing medicine for the mother wolf, they also cooked for the two wolf cubs every day.
Ever since Lu Yao and the others first shared cooked food with the two little guys, they seemed to have opened the door to a new world, developing a strong interest in cooked food. Whenever Lu Yao or the others started a fire to cook, the two wolf cubs would sneak over from a distance when the adults weren't looking, cautiously approaching An Hun to freeload.
In fact, the wolf king had already noticed it with keen eyes. As a leader who possessed both wisdom and strength, it had taken note of the children's little actions from the very beginning, but it did not interfere.
Only the two cubs thought they had fooled their father. Every time they came, they would turn back every two steps, constantly watching their father's movements, as if afraid that their little tricks would be discovered. Little did they know that their father had known all along. From the very beginning when the two cubs sneaked past, the wolf king had been quietly waiting not far away.
Lu Yao and his companions naturally noticed the wolves' "secret activities." Seeing how cute the two were, they didn't expose them. So, every day, the two wolves would sneak over, pretending not to see them, and everyone would feed them.
The wolf king's mate woke up the next day. After rubbing against each other for a long time, the two wolves looked up at Lu Yao and the others and expressed their deep gratitude to them with a low and long howl.
As time went by, the mother wolf gradually recovered, and the wolf pack's life slowly returned to its former rhythm. The wolf king began to go hunting more frequently, returning each time with a rich haul, and would specially send some to Lu Yao and the others as a reward for their help.
Perhaps seeing that his cubs got along very well with Lu Yao and the others, the wolf king was not in a hurry to leave the land that had given them warmth and help with his mate and children.
However, good times are always fleeting. When Lu Yao and the others finally filled their earthenware jars with crystal-clear salt, it signified the time for parting and their impending journey home. Facing the impending separation, everyone felt a mix of emotions.
After spending so many days together, everyone had developed a deep affection for the two lively, adorable, and curious wolf cubs. However, everyone also knew that all good things must come to an end. Although they were reluctant to part with them, they understood that their encounter with the two wolf cubs was a beautiful accident.
They began to quietly pack their belongings, burying the beautiful times they had spent with the wolf cubs deep in their hearts. The wolf king and the mother wolf seemed to sense the impending separation as well. After talking with his wife and cubs, the wolf king led several adult wolves out.
When Lu Yao saw them again, they were carrying some plants in their mouths. The wolf king led them to place the plants near Lu Yao and the others, then quickly retreated. Looking at their actions, Lu Yao felt puzzled and walked forward to examine the plants.
Luo Ya and the others also gathered around. They turned over the plants on the ground, and Lu Yao gradually recognized that the plant looked like a wild peanut, which surprised her greatly.
"What are these? Are these beans? Can we eat them?" Lu Yao looked in the direction of the person who spoke and saw some round, yellow beans growing on the plant stem in his hand.
Lu Yao's hands trembled as she picked them up to examine them. She gently held them in her palms, scrutinizing every detail. She could hardly believe her eyes—they really were soybeans! Lu Yao was overjoyed.
Lu Yao's excitement was palpable. The others couldn't understand why she was so happy to see these plants, and they exchanged puzzled glances.
"These are all good things, we can eat them! I never expected the Wolf King to give us such a big gift," Lu Yao said, unable to hide her excitement. The others were also very happy, infected by Lu Yao's excitement, and they had so many kinds of food.
She turned towards the wolf king's direction and danced with joy, saying, "Thank you!"
The wolf king and the other wolves were also very pleased to see Lu Yao and the others so happy.
Lu Yao and her companions carefully gathered the plants and began their journey home. The wolf king and his family watched them leave, their howls echoing through the forest, startling the birds into flight. Lu Yao turned back to look at the wolf king and his family in the distance and silently said, "Goodbye, Wolf King."
